文件名称:opcua-asyncio:适用于python> 3.6 asyncio的OPC UA库
文件大小:1.07MB
文件格式:ZIP
更新时间:2024-03-02 11:56:59
protocol python3 asyncio opc-ua opcua
适用于Python> = 3.7和pypy3的OPC UA / IEC 62541客户端和服务器。 , 视神经异步 opcua-asyncio是基于python-opcua的基于异步的异步OPC UA客户端和服务器,不再支持python <3.7。 异步编程可以简化代码(例如,减少对锁的需求)并可能提高性能。 该库还具有基于异步API的,可用于同步代码而不是python-opcua OPC UA二进制协议实现非常完整,并且已经针对许多不同的OPC UA堆栈进行了测试。 API提供了用于发送和接收所有UA定义的结构的低级接口以及允许在几行中编写服务器或客户端的高级类。 在一个应用程序中轻松混合高级对象和低级UA调用。 大多数低级代码是从xml规范自动生成的,因此向客户端或服务器添加缺少的功能通常很简单。 coverage.py报告测试覆盖率超过95%的代码,大多数未经测试的代码是尚未